This afternoon my 19 week old australorp starting acting strange suddenly. A flock of wild turkeys had flown into the yard, my dogs were chasing them, and there was a big commotion. During this, the hens were all hiding under the coop. (their run is completely enclosed.) The australorp kept making these loud bak bakking noises over and over, then she continued to stay under the coop after the other hens had calmed down and were out grazing again in their run. She seemed to be falling asleep on her feet, and the membrane under one eye kept coming up and covering the eye. Although she did come out and graze a bit and drink water, she looks kind of hunched up and her feathers are looking spikey. My husband thinks she is having a prolonged panic/freeze reaction. The others are all ok.
Any ideas from those who are more experienced?
 
As it all turned out, she was getting ready to lay the first egg but because I was new to chickens didn't recognize the signs. The turkeys had nothing to do with it! Silly me.
